Exports by Country
The Netherlands dominates exports structure, accounting for X tons, which was approx. 97% of total exports in 2022. Belgium (X tons) took a little share of total exports.
From 2012 to 2022, average annual rates of growth with regard to titanium exports from the Netherlands stood at -16.0%. Belgium (-2.0%) illustrated a downward trend over the same period. While the share of Belgium (+2.4 p.p.) increased significantly in terms of the total exports from 2012-2022, the share of the Netherlands (-2.4 p.p.) displayed negative dynamics.
In value terms, the Netherlands ($X) remains the largest titanium supplier in Benelux, comprising 95%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was held by Belgium ($X), with a 5.4% share of total exports.
From 2012 to 2022, the average annual rate of growth in terms of value in the Netherlands amounted to -15.6%.

Imports by Country
In 2022, the Netherlands (X tons) was the major importer of titanium sponge, powders, ingots and slabs, comprising 87% of total imports. It was distantly followed by Belgium (X tons), comprising a 13% share of total imports.
From 2012 to 2022, average annual rates of growth with regard to titanium imports into the Netherlands stood at -15.8%. Belgium experienced a relatively flat trend pattern. From 2012 to 2022, the share of Belgium increased by +10 percentage points.
In value terms, the Netherlands ($X) constitutes the largest market for imported titanium sponge, powders, ingots and slabs in Benelux, comprising 68%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was held by Belgium ($X), with a 32% share of total imports.
In the Netherlands, titanium imports decreased by an average annual rate of -17.1% over the period from 2012-2022.
